The Chosen


     The Chosen is the story of Rashel Jordan, a seventeen year old vampire hunter who’s mother was murdered by Hunter Redfern, one of the oldest vampires around.  Rashel belongs to a group called the Lancers, an organization of vampire hunters.  When she goes on an expedition to a warehouse with a few other members of the group to follow up on rumours of kidnapped girls, she never expects that the vampire they’ll catch will turn out to be her soulmate, Quinn, who was first introduced to us in Daughters of Darkness.  Quinn and Rashel may not understand what’s happening between them, but whatever it is is intense, and suddenly Rashel can’t bring herself to kill him.  She lets him get away, something that gets her in trouble with the rest of the group.  Then she begins to feel guilty.  She decides to do whatever she can to wipe out the vampires.  When she happens to be in the right place at the right time to save one of the kidnapped girls who was being taken away in a truck, she finds out that some sort of operation, she believes slave trading, is going on.  As she learns more, she finds that Quinn is one of the vampires involved.  Vowing to destroy Quinn and to save the girls, Rashel goes undercover and gets herself kidnapped.  She is taken to an island, where she learns that the girls are not intended as slaves at all but as part of a bloodfeast.  Working quickly, she gets the girls ready to escape, and then Quinn shows up again.  She tries but, just like before, cannot bring herself to kill him.  When Quinn realizes who she is though, he takes her to a room where Rashel believes he intends to murder her, and tells her that he’s in love with her.  Rashel, crazy as it seems, is in love with him as well.  They’re soulmates and Quinn, seeing no other alternative, wants to turn her into a vampire.  Rashel manages to convince him not to though, and together they decide to stop the bloodfeast.  Unfortunately it’s not as easy as they think.  They threaten the other vampires that they will turn them in to Hunter Redfern, only to find out that Hunter Redfern is the one behind the bloodfeast to begin with.  They are saved by a fire, started by one of the girls who’s out for revenge, and manage to get away, where they realize that the only place they have left to go is to Circle Daybreak, the organization that aims to bring humans and night people together.

     This book is important for a lot of reasons.  First of all, it plays on a subject mentioned in Daughters of Darkness, that of vampire hunters.  Next, it begins to show Circle Daybreak’s importance.  From now on Circle Daybreak and their mission is an important aspect of the series.  It brings up the human slave trade which is later central to the plot of Black Dawn.  It also shows Hunter Redfern, one of the most powerful vampires, attempting to make changes in the Night World.
